Why It's Time to Replace Your Window Hinges
Window hinges are an essential element of every window. They prevent windows from closing and causing safety hazard. They also control airflow, keeping your home comfortable and energy-efficient.
There are several types of window hinges to choose from, each with its own merits and characteristics. This article will examine the main factors to take into consideration when selecting replacement hinges for windows.
Durability
Window hinges are an important element of the overall functionality and longevity of windows. High-quality hinges for windows are able to endure the elements and stop windows from closing suddenly. This could be dangerous for pets or children. They also help regulate airflow and keep the indoors cool while cutting down on energy costs. If your window hinges have become damaged or worn, it is advisable to replace them as soon as possible. This is a simple DIY project that will save you money on repair window hinges costs and help to prolong the life of your windows.
The material used to make them is a significant factor in their durability. Hinges made of durable materials like brass, stainless steel, or zinc-aluminum alloys are resistant to wear, corrosion and extreme weather conditions. They also can support heavier window sashes which reduces the stress placed on the hinges.
In addition to the material in addition to the material, the design of hinges is also a factor in their longevity. Hinges with multiple bearing points spread the weight of the sash more evenly, which prevents the hinges from wearing out or being damaged. Hinges with adjustable tension also let you adjust the amount of pressure that is applied to the sash.
Before replacing hinges, it's crucial to determine the kind of hinge. Installing a hinge type that isn't compatible with the existing one can lead to a variety of problems, such as difficulties opening and closing the window, inadequate ventilation, and possibly dangers to your safety.

Energy efficiency
The quality of hinges can play a significant role in determining the energy efficiency of windows. The quality of hinges will determine whether or not they create gaps between the frame and sash. This could allow warm air to escape in winter, and cold air to get in during the summer. This results in higher energy bills. Windows hinges that are properly installed and matched will ensure that windows remain tightly sealed. This can reduce energy consumption and minimizes air flow.
The energy efficiency of sash window hinges depends on the material, style and performance. Brass, stainless steel and aluminum hinges are the most popular choices because of their durability and capability to endure long-term use. They are also lightweight and have a sleek look. However, these materials can be susceptible to corrosion, especially in damp conditions. For this reason, it is essential to select a sturdy hinge that has been designed to adapt to different weather and climate conditions.

Hinges with thermal breaks and insulation materials reduce heat transfer. This reduces thermal bridging which occurs when heat escapes the insulation and passes through the hinge mechanism. The resulting reduction in air leakage and drafts helps to maintain a consistent indoor temperature, improves occupant comfort, and reduces cooling and heating costs.
A proper maintenance routine is essential to ensure the longevity of the sash window hinges. Regular cleaning and lubrication can help to avoid the build-up of dirt that can cause damage to the hinges over time. In addition, periodic inspections are able to detect indications of wear and tear or damage, which can be dealt with immediately to stop the damage from getting worse.
Security
Window hinges form a crucial connection between the frame and sash of the window that allows them to close and open. As such, they need to be capable of supporting the weight of the window sash without causing damage or suffering wear and tear. To do this, they must be constructed from materials that are sturdy and resistant to corrosion. They should be simple to maintain and install, thus reducing the chance of sustaining damage.
A high-quality pair of hinges that are replacements can enhance the security of a window to deter intruders and maintain an encapsulated seal between the inside and outside of your business or home. A hinge that is well-designed will be able hold the weight of the window without straining and should also feature locking mechanisms that can enhance home security.
The quality of the hinges on windows is affected by factors such as the type and design and the place they are installed, and how they are employed. Understanding these issues will allow homeowners to choose the best hinges for their window and avoid common issues such as misalignment or incorrect installations. A poor installation can cause a number of problems such as poor window performance and lower energy efficiency.
Damaged catches can also cause casement windows as well as other hinged windows to snap repeatedly shut during bad weather. This causes further damage to both the glass and frame. It is important to fix any hinge problems as soon as you can, since repairs that are quick can save you time and money in the long term.
